Figma MCP Design-to-Code

Translate Figma designs into production code through the Figma MCP server, following a strict fetch-then-implement workflow.

Overview

The Figma MCP server exposes tools that return structured design data, screenshots, variable definitions, and code-connect mappings for any Figma node. Call MCP tools in a defined sequence, receive structured JSON and code scaffolding (defaulting to React + Tailwind), then adapt output to the target project's conventions.

Workflow

Every Figma-driven implementation follows this sequence. Do not skip steps.

Step 1: Fetch Design Context

Call get_design_context with the Figma frame/layer URL. The server extracts the node-id from the link and returns structured design data plus React + Tailwind code.

bash
get_design_context(url="https://www.figma.com/design/FILE_KEY/Name?node-id=123-456")

If the response is truncated, call get_metadata first to get a sparse XML outline of child node IDs, then re-call get_design_context targeting specific children:

bash
get_metadata(url="https://www.figma.com/design/FILE_KEY/Name?node-id=123-456")
get_design_context(url="https://www.figma.com/design/FILE_KEY/Name?node-id=789-012")

Step 2: Capture Visual Reference

Call get_screenshot for the node variant being implemented:

bash
get_screenshot(url="https://www.figma.com/design/FILE_KEY/Name?node-id=123-456")

Use the screenshot to verify layout, spacing, and visual hierarchy during implementation.

Step 3: Download Assets and Implement

Only after Steps 1 and 2 are complete:

  1. Download image/SVG assets from the MCP server response
  2. If the server returns a localhost source for an image or SVG, use it directly -- do not create placeholders
  3. Do not import new icon packages; all assets come from the Figma payload
  4. Translate the React + Tailwind scaffold into the project's framework conventions
  5. Replace Tailwind utility classes with project design-system tokens (--color-primary, --spacing-md)
  6. Reuse existing components (buttons, inputs, typography) instead of duplicating
  7. Validate against the Figma screenshot for 1:1 visual parity

Step 4: Extract Design Variables (Optional)

Call get_variable_defs to list colors, spacing, and typography variables used in the selection. Map these to your project's token system:

bash
get_variable_defs(url="https://www.figma.com/design/FILE_KEY/Name?node-id=123-456")
# Returns: { "colors": [{ "name": "Primary/500", "value": "#6366F1" }], ... }

Step 5: Map Code Connect (Optional)

Use get_code_connect_map to check if a node already maps to an existing component, and add_code_connect_map to register new mappings:

bash
get_code_connect_map(url="https://www.figma.com/design/FILE_KEY/Name?node-id=123-456")
# Returns: { "codeConnectSrc": "src/components/ui/Button.tsx", "codeConnectName": "Button" }

add_code_connect_map(nodeId="123-456", codeConnectSrc="src/components/ui/Card.tsx", codeConnectName="Card")

Best Practices

Do

  • Always run the full fetch sequence: get_design_context -> get_screenshot -> implement
  • Use get_metadata before get_design_context when nodes are large (100+ layers)
  • Use get_variable_defs to align Figma variables with project tokens
  • Reuse existing project components; check get_code_connect_map first
  • Register new component mappings with add_code_connect_map after implementation
  • Use the project's color system (--color-*), typography scale, and spacing tokens
  • Validate final UI against the Figma screenshot for look and behavior

Avoid

  • Skipping get_design_context and going straight to implementation
  • Treating MCP-generated React + Tailwind as final production code
  • Importing new icon packages when assets are in the Figma payload
  • Creating placeholder images when a localhost source URL is provided
  • Hardcoding pixel values instead of using design-system tokens
  • Duplicating existing components instead of checking code connect maps

Common Questions

Q: The get_design_context response is truncated?

A: Call get_metadata first to get the XML outline with child node IDs. Then re-call get_design_context on individual child nodes instead of the parent container.

Q: How do I adapt the React + Tailwind output for Vue or Svelte?

A: Add a framework directive to the prompt: "generate my Figma selection in Vue" or "in Svelte with TypeScript". The MCP server adjusts the scaffold accordingly.

Q: The Figma MCP server returns a localhost URL for an image?

A: Use the localhost URL directly as the src attribute. The MCP server hosts assets at a local endpoint during the session. Never replace it with a placeholder or external URL.

Examples

Example 1: Implement a Card Component

code
User: Build the pricing card from https://figma.com/design/XYZ/App?node-id=42-100
Assistant:
  1. get_design_context(url="...?node-id=42-100")
     -> Returns Card JSX with Tailwind classes, 3 child layers
  2. get_screenshot(url="...?node-id=42-100")
     -> PNG showing card with title, price, feature list, CTA button
  3. get_variable_defs(url="...?node-id=42-100")
     -> colors: Primary/500=#6366F1, Gray/100=#F3F4F6
     -> spacing: card-padding=24px, card-gap=16px
  4. Check get_code_connect_map -> Button already mapped to src/components/ui/Button.tsx
  5. Translate: Replace Tailwind classes with project tokens, reuse Button component
  6. Compare screenshot with rendered output -> 1:1 match

Example 2: Handle a Large Page Layout

code
User: Implement the dashboard layout from https://figma.com/design/ABC/Dashboard?node-id=1-200
Assistant:
  1. get_design_context(url="...?node-id=1-200")
     -> Response truncated (200+ layers)
  2. get_metadata(url="...?node-id=1-200")
     -> XML outline: Sidebar(node-id=1-201), Header(1-202), MainContent(1-203)
  3. get_design_context(url="...?node-id=1-201") -> Sidebar JSX
  4. get_design_context(url="...?node-id=1-202") -> Header JSX
  5. get_design_context(url="...?node-id=1-203") -> MainContent JSX
  6. get_screenshot for each section
  7. Compose layout, reuse existing grid system and components
